THE BEST MULLED WINE
We love a well-spiced, fragrant mulled wine and this one hits the spot. The spices steep in the cider to intensify their flavors before everything is combined to create a warming, winter drink.
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Categories beverage
Time 20h
Yield 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Add the cider, cloves, cinnamon, allspice and peppercorns to a medium pot. Bring to a boil, then lower the heat and simmer until reduced by a third, about 10 minutes.
- Strain the cider through a sieve into a clean pot, then discard the spices. Add the red wine, port, half the clementines and half the apples. Cover and cook over medium-high heat until warmed through, 5 to 7 minutes.
- Reduce the heat to low to keep warm. Garnish cups of warm mulled wine with the remaining fresh apple and clementine slices. (Do not serve the steeped fruit from the pot.)

MULLED WINE
Steps:
- Begin by placing the cloves, peppercorns, cinnamon and star anise into a large piece of cheesecloth. Make a pouch and tie it with kitchen twine.
- In a large nonreactive pot over medium heat, add the wine, honey, lemon zest and juice, orange zest and juice and the cheesecloth of spices and bring to a simmer (be sure not to bring to a boil). Simmer for 30 minutes, and then add the brandy.
- When ready to serve, remove the cheesecloth of spices and ladle into warm mugs.

INSTANT POT MULLED WINE
The Instant Pot® makes quick work of infusing holiday spices into your wine. Set to keep warm and serve this festive beverage straight from the pot at your next party!
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Time 35m
Yield 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Add the cider, cloves, cinnamon, allspice and peppercorns to a 6-quart Instant Pot®. Follow the manufacturer's guide for locking the lid and preparing to cook. Set to pressure cook on high pressure for 3 minutes (see Cook's Note).
- After the pressure cook cycle is complete, follow the manufacturer's guide for quick release and wait until the quick release cycle is complete. Be careful of any remaining steam and unlock and remove the lid.
- Strain the cider through a sieve, then discard the spices and return the cider to the pot. Set to saute on high, then add the red wine, port, half the clementines and half the apples. Cover with the glass lid and cook until warmed through, about 5 minutes (take are not to let it boil).
- Set the pot to keep warm and garnish with the remaining clementine and apple slices.

EASY MULLED WINE
This mulled wine recipe couldn't be easier to do. Don't bother with expensive wine - a cheap red will work beautifully and no one will ever know the difference! Start with a little sugar, then add more to taste. This recipe can be easily doubled or trebled.
Provided by Diana Moutsopoulos
Categories Mulled Wine
Time 25m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Combine red wine, cinnamon sticks, cloves, allspice, lemon peel, and orange peel in a heavy saucepan over medium heat. Heat gently, but don't boil. Stir in 2 tablespoons of sugar, and once dissolved, taste to see if you'd like to add more.
- Keep hot on medium to low heat for 20 minutes to let the flavors infuse the wine. Serve your mulled wine hot in glasses or mugs.
